Subject: [PATCH 4/5] git-commit-tree: add support for prior

Add support in git-commit-tree for -r as well as associated
documentation.
---
Documentation/git-commit-tree.txt | 6 ++++++
commit-tree.c | 26 +++++++++++++++++++++-----
2 files changed, 27 insertions(+), 5 deletions(-)
diff --git a/Documentation/git-commit-tree.txt b/Documentation/git-commit-tree.txt
index 27b3d12..e11ba1f 100644
--- a/Documentation/git-commit-tree.txt
+++ b/Documentation/git-commit-tree.txt
@@ -20,6 +20,9 @@ A commit object usually has 1 parent (a
to 16 parents. More than one parent represents a merge of branches
that led to them.
+A commit object can have 1 prior commit. This represents the previous
+commit that this one replaces (including history).
+
While a tree represents a particular directory state of a working
directory, a commit represents that state in "time", and explains how
to get there.
@@ -38,6 +41,8 @@ OPTIONS
-p <parent commit>::
Each '-p' indicates the id of a parent commit object.
+-r <other commit>::
+ One '-r' indicates the id of a prior commit object.
Commit Information
------------------
@@ -45,6 +50,7 @@ Commit Information
A commit encapsulates:
- all parent object ids
+- a prior object id (optional)
- author name, email and date
- committer name and email and the commit time.
diff --git a/commit-tree.c b/commit-tree.c
index 2d86518..6660b01 100644
--- a/commit-tree.c
+++ b/commit-tree.c
@@ -61,8 +61,9 @@ static void check_valid(unsigned char *s
*/
#define MAXPARENT (16)
static unsigned char parent_sha1[MAXPARENT][20];
+static unsigned char prior_sha1[21] = "\0";
-static const char commit_tree_usage[] = "git-commit-tree <sha1> [-p <sha1>]* < changelog";
+static const char commit_tree_usage[] = "git-commit-tree <sha1> [-p <sha1>]* [-r <sha1>] < changelog";
static int new_parent(int idx)
{
@@ -99,11 +100,22 @@ int main(int argc, char **argv)
for (i = 2; i < argc; i += 2) {
char *a, *b;
a = argv[i]; b = argv[i+1];
- if (!b || strcmp(a, "-p") || get_sha1(b, parent_sha1[parents]))
+ if (!b)
usage(commit_tree_usage);
- check_valid(parent_sha1[parents], commit_type);
- if (new_parent(parents))
- parents++;
+ if (!strcmp(a, "-p")) {
+ if (get_sha1(b, parent_sha1[parents]) < 0)
+ usage(commit_tree_usage);
+ check_valid(parent_sha1[parents], commit_type);
+ if (new_parent(parents))
+ parents++;
+ }
+ else if (!strcmp(a, "-r")) {
+ if (strcmp(&prior_sha1, "") || get_sha1(b, &prior_sha1) < 0)
+ usage(commit_tree_usage);
+ }
+ else {
+ usage(commit_tree_usage);
+ }
}
if (!parents)
fprintf(stderr, "Committing initial tree %s\n", argv[1]);
@@ -118,6 +130,10 @@ int main(int argc, char **argv)
*/
for (i = 0; i < parents; i++)
add_buffer(&buffer, &size, "parent %s\n", sha1_to_hex(parent_sha1[i]));
+ if (strcmp(&prior_sha1, "")) {
+ fprintf(stderr, "Setting prior to %s\n", sha1_to_hex(&prior_sha1));
+ add_buffer(&buffer, &size, "prior %s\n", sha1_to_hex(&prior_sha1));
+ }
/* Person/date information */
add_buffer(&buffer, &size, "author %s\n", git_author_info(1));
